Meet Gordon Estlack DPT

Dr. Gordon Estlack, DPT, OCS, GCS, Cert MDT is a physical therapist and a board-certified clinical specialist in orthopaedics and geriatrics. He is also certified by the McKenzie Institute USA in Mechanical Diagnosis and Treatment for conditions of the spine. He is originally from Southington, OH. After receiving his associate and bachelor’s degrees from Kent State University, he earned his Master of Physical Therapy degree from the University of Findlay and his Doctor of Physical Therapy degree through A.T. Still University. He completed clinical rotations with HealthSouth in Cleveland, OH; the Cleveland Clinic; St. Rita’s Hospital in Lima, OH; and ProMedica at Spring Meadows, OH. He is an adjunct professor of Physical Therapy at the University of Findlay.

He treats various spinal disorders and sports injuries, as well as common conditions affecting the upper and lower extremities. He has extensive post-operative rehabilitation experience and utilizes manual techniques, exercise, modalities, and dry needling in his practice. He strives to maintain a caring relationship with his patients in order to provide individualized, optimal care.
